1,028,038 is a composite number, even.
1,028,038 (one million twenty-eight thousand thirty-eight)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 11 × 83 × 563. Written other ways, in hexadecimal, 0xFAFC6.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 1028038, here are decompositions:
- 107 + 1027931 = 1028038
- 197 + 1027841 = 1028038
- 239 + 1027799 = 1028038
- 251 + 1027787 = 1028038
- 281 + 1027757 = 1028038
- 311 + 1027727 = 1028038
- 359 + 1027679 = 1028038
- 491 + 1027547 = 1028038
Showing the first eight; more decompositions exist.
